The purpose of this course is to identify effective applications of online teaching that help guide student success, encourage a respectful learning environment and present engaging content in an online class.
Faculty should successfully pass this course prior to teaching online for Central Piedmont Community College.
​
CPCC has developed and adopted a set of Online Teaching Competencies that specify the skills and behaviors an instructor must consistently exhibit while teaching an online class.
